gpt4 book ai didi

css - 媒体查询问题。风景和肖像

转载 作者:行者123 更新时间:2023-11-28 18:30:41 24 4
gpt4 key购买 nike

我已经围绕 stackoverflow 进行了一些搜索,但似乎都没有解决我的问题,因此我在这里发帖。

我有一张 table 。它有六排。我做了一个媒体查询(@media only screen and (max-device-width: 480px)),这样在手机上查看时表格不会扭曲页面。媒体查询本身本质上只是在做 display: none;在 tr 类上。

但是,我遇到的问题是最大设备宽度设置为 480 像素。所以很自然地人们会认为当超过时,字段会返回。我的手机(Nokia Lumia 800)的分辨率为 480x800,因此在纵向模式下它应该隐藏 tr。然而,在风景中,它们应该重新出现,因为那将是 800x480 的分辨率。这基本上是我的问题。尽管进行了视口(viewport)测试并且它说它是,但它们并没有重新出现。

有人知道为什么会这样吗?

最佳答案

本质上,当用户低于 480px 时,您的代码中发生的事情是告诉 css 隐藏元素并且在运行时保存状态。当用户超过 480px 时,您没有规则让这个元素脱离 (display:none) 状态。

CSS 以级联方式工作,因此最后一条规则将成为浏览器默认的规则。

如果您有一个查询说明低于 480 像素的显示:隐藏,您将需要另一个查询来说明高于 480 像素的显示:阻止。

关于css - 媒体查询问题。风景和肖像,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14451608/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com